Ayes: lance as it pertains e sign regulations, oved from each of displayed will be the changes at the Aric Schroeder, Senior Planner, reviewed amendment to the Zoning Ordina lice as it pertains to accessory building regulations. The changes include: 1. Increase the allowable detached accessory structures from 800 to 850 square feet. 2. Place a limit on the size of attached accessory structures to the size of the dwelling. 3. Exempt any structure less than 9 square feet and up to two accessory structures that are less than 25 square feet from being included in the accessory limit to account for small storage bins or other similar structures. 4. Prohibit accessory structures greater than 120 square feet t be constructed of metal siding, except for horizontal aluminum siding com on on residential structures, to help ensure that accessory structures are compa 'ble with residential structures. Freestanding metal framed carports or similar structures would be prohibit on any residential property as they are considered incompatible to a residential neighborhoo . A public hearing will be held on the changes at the September 20, 2004 council meeting.
